Jim Jost

With over two decades of experience in the film industry, Jim has credits on Hawaii 5-0, Numb3rs, Alias and The Parent Trap, among others. He was cinematographer on Election Night, an AFI short film which will premiere as part of the Emerging Filmmaker Showcase at the American Pavilion at Cannes 2015. He also shot and produced Leave Keys in Car, winner of an Award of Excellence at the Best Shorts Fest, Best of Fest selection at Bahamas International Film Festival, and Best Comedy at the Lady Filmmaker Festival.

Jim wrote, directed and shot Cubed a short film trilogy currently in post production and Kenobi Cube, which was honored in Honolulu's Showdown in Chinatown. He also operated on The Bungler's, Recipient of the Platinum Award for Cinematography at the 45th WorldFest Houston International Film Festival.

 

Stasia Droze Jost

As photographer and commercial director, Stasia's clients include Nike, Sony and Hanes. She has photographed Will Smith, Mohammed Ali and Maria Sharapova. Stasia was a producer on Tessa Blake's action/comedy, Leave Keys In Car, winner Best comedy at the Lady Filmmaker Festival, a Best of Fest selection at Bahamas International Film Festival, and a Award of Excellence at the Best Shorts Fest. 

Stasia went on to produce a trilogy of short films, honored in Honolulu's Showdown in Chinatown. Recently, she produced Election Night- also directed by Blake -starring Peri Gilpin (Frasier) and comedian Jake Johannsen, which will premiere as part of the Emerging Filmmaker Showcase at the American Pavilion at Cannes 2015.
